Francis de Vries played the 2nd half of his combine team at the MLS combine. His team, 'Chaos' were 3-0 down at halftime but 2nd half with de Vries they managed to keep a clean sheet and pull a goal back. de Vries is looking strong and a MLS mock draft had him picked as high as 18th in the 1st round. I will be attending the MLS draft this week and will be interesting to see how he goes.
Technically good enough for the MLS but will need to show that he can match the physicality and pace at a higher level, during these combine games.

So de Vries has been drafted 7th in round 2, 29th overall pick. Slightly surprised considering mock drafts had him between 18-12 and had him as the 3rd best center back at the draft after having a solid combine series and showing that he could keep up with the fastest players there. (Which was Mandy's concern over him)
Being an international player definitely hurt him. And to take a teams international slot you are going to have to be a player fighting at least for the starting 11. Will definitely be a training player and would see him link up with fellow kiwi Deklan Wynne. It's hard being a center back at this level due to experienced needed but also that in MLS the spine of the team are where all the designated players are.
Kip Colvey seeing at SJ was 3rd choice left back but after 2 injuries above him he got his chance. It has helped that he is half American too. But also kinder for him as MLS are not stacked with quality left backs nor right backs. This is helped with the fact that no team wastes their big money contracts (designated player) on fullbacks
